Attorneys/Proceedings:
requires attorney who applies to represent persons in postconviction capital
collateral proceedings to certify that he or she is not currently
representing more than nine persons in such proceedings; directs that
attorney may not represent more than 10 persons in postconviction capital
collateral proceedings at any one time. Amends 27.710,.711.
